Marriage is one of the most important topics to discuss in a relationship. It’s the ultimate display of dedication, resulting in a large celebration and, of course, a lot of paperwork.

You may not realise it, but where you live in the United States can have an impact on your marriage prospects. The likelihood of a couple marrying depends on factors such as the economies of individual states and the ease with which they can get married.

Schmidt & Clark, a law firm, crunched the numbers to determine the ten states with the highest and lowest marriage rates.

Schmidt and Clark used data from the US Census Bureau’s American Community Survey. They analysed the marriage history of residents over the age of 15 in each state to determine the percentage of married people.

Marriage history included both the percentage of residents who never married and those who did marry. Schmidt and Clark also took into account how often married people remarried. They then used the data to rank the top ten states where Americans are most likely to marry.

Schmidt and Clark’s ranking is not consistent with other marriage data. In a 2023 report, Nevada had the highest marriage rate of any state, with 26.2 per 1,000 people.
